How was your experience with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
Mostly have dealt directly with the nurse, but the times that we have met with the doctor, she has been pleasant and informative. She didn't, however, say anything or do anything that would suggest her feelings towards lgbtq couples in any way or disclose any training she's had as pertaining to lgbtq couples and potential parents.
What's one piece of advice would you give a prospective patient of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
Advocate for yourself and ask clarification questions when you don't understand something.
During treatment, were you treated like a number or a human with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
She was direct and answered questions when present.
Describe the protocols Channing Burks Chatmon used in your cycles at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ic) and their degree of success.
First attempt, which failed, was with 5 mg of letrozole and ovidrel trigger shot. Also had hysterscopy to remove polyps.
Describe your experience with your nurse at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ic). (Assigned nurse: Ellen)
Don't really have any complaints. Communicated mostly through the portal
Describe your experience with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ic).
I imagine they're comparable to other clinics. They weren't pushy about anything which we appreciated. It was comfortable. I appreciated that kids were not permitted to be in the clinic. Would love more lgbtq messaging.
Describe the costs associated with your care under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ic).
Hysteroscopy cost >$1k with anesthesia out of pocket. Medications were >$100. IUI covered by insurance.

How was your experience with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
Dr. Burks lacks accountability. When I was going through a spontaneous miscarriage she forgot to call in medications for me in time and then refused to acknowledge her error while I was in the greatest pain in my life. Also, my first frozen transfer, my estrogen was way too high (something I realized after I left her care) and I should've never been cleared to transfer. This wasted a perfectly healthy, euploid embryo.
What's one piece of advice would you give a prospective patient of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
Do your own research. She encouraged me NOT to do my own research which should've been a sign right there. Make sure your labs are in a good range yourself.
During treatment, were you treated like a number or a human with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ic)?
Dr. Burks was not the most empathetic.
Describe the protocols Channing Burks Chatmon used in your cycles at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ic) and their degree of success.
3 IUIs, 2 IVF retrievals (agonist and antagonist protocols), and 2 FETs (medicated and modified natural).
Describe your experience with your nurse at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ic). (Assigned nurse: Ellen)
A very kind and compassionate nurse. There were times she wasn't very knowledgeable but she was always compassionate.
Describe your experience with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ic).
Definitely runs like a factory. It's huge but its nice that they have so many locations and have times during the weekend. Very convenient. Their billing/insurance department is a nightmare unless you're dealing with the manager. Also the River North location has nice advancements in technology. Some of the receptionists and phlebotemists in the suburban locations are amazing. The ones in River North aren't as amazing.
Describe the costs associated with your care under Channing Burks Chatmon at Fertility Centers of Illinois (US Fertility Network clinic).
It was covered under insurance.
